Dave Lieberman keeps things simple, quick, and inexpensive as he shows how to prepare delicious meals. He plans everything from barbecues to dinner parties to wedding dinners. As he cooks, Dave gives tips on everything food-related, such as food storage, presentation, and how to buy the right kind of food. Great meals don't have to cost a lot of money!moreless
